The Rusalka is a rare corrosive foe, found principally in the Havensdale Bridge scenario. As with most monsters that incur a permanent debuff, avoiding taking damage from them is very advisable. Rusalka also leave corrosive puddles instead of blood pools. There are a number of ways to avoid these blood pools; using the Glyph: WEYTWUT WEYTWUT, Glyph: WONAFYT WONAFYT, or Glyph: PISORF PISORF glyphs to move the Rusalka before you kill it is one option. Another option is to carve an alternate path with Glyph: ENDISWAL ENDISWAL. Finally, you could use Glyph: LEMMISI LEMMISI or Glyph: BLUDTUPOWA BLUDTUPOWA to reveal a tile on the other side of the puddle, allowing you to "jump" over it. Curing corrosion is quite difficult, requiring a Item: Burn Salve Burn Salve or a deity's boon.
